A320 First Officer | Air Arabia Group – Dammam, Saudi Arabia

✈️ A320 First Officer – Join Air Arabia Group in Dammam

  • Airline: Air Arabia Group
  • Location: Dammam, Saudi Arabia
  • Base: Dammam (KSA)
  • Fleet: Airbus A320 family
  • License required: ATPL

🌟 What you’ll bring

  • Valid ATPL (appropriate authority).
  • Minimum 4,000 hours total flight time.
  • A320 experience (highly preferred).
  • Valid Class 1 Medical.
  • Successful completion of technical and psychometric assessments (company standard).
  • Training in safety and emergency response; strong knowledge of aircraft systems.
  • Very good written and verbal communication skills with strong English proficiency.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office for reports and documentation.
  • Crew Resource Management training (advantage).
  • Experience with a low-cost carrier model (highly desirable).
  • Knowledge of QA, Safety, Security, and Audit procedures.
  • Proven decision-making and problem-solving skills; high acc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Ability to perform under changing conditions and heavy workload schedules.
